Single-Stall Unit Specifications
Our standard unit measures 43" wide by 47" deep with 90" height clearance and a 60-gallon holding tank. It includes a molded urinal, interior shelf, foot pump, and translucent roof. See standard porta potty rental rates by duration. Call (916) 374-7478 for availability.
- Footprint: 43 x 47 x 90 in., anchor-ready
- Tank: 60-gallon waste reservoir, blue masking liquid
- Capacity: 7-10 days per worker between services
- Build: Ribbed HDPE shell, vented translucent roof

Servicing Schedule with Holding Tank Capacity
One worker uses a single tank for seven to ten days with weekly service. High-traffic sites require a twice-weekly cadence. Our vacuum truck performs a full pump out at the same location to keep the porta potty on schedule.
A typical visit covers a vacuum pump-out and a disinfectant wipe-down, where the technician runs a suction hose into the tank to remove grey water. Standard Unit Questions
-
+ How long can one unit serve a worker?
A 60-gallon tank serves one full-time worker for about seven to ten days before the next pump-out.
-
+ What surface do I need?
Any reasonably level surface like gravel, concrete, asphalt, or packed dirt keeps the unit anchored.
-
+ Do I need a right-of-way permit?
If a unit sits on a sidewalk or parking lane in Sacramento, the city applies an encroachment permit.
